Output 8b7262cc9c61a683071f7a31963c1561a6bb410c9500a931609bde1f29930977:1

value
21626323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ed4e3c90f28058a9b36cc88bc6ee989187131763 OP_EQUAL
address
3PKmnyr2VhcMqUG4PdK1nejoEJZx5ciEgW
transaction
8b7262cc9c61a683071f7a31963c1561a6bb410c9500a931609bde1f29930977
spent
true